Frank Lary posted a career Total Average of .341, well below the league average of .678 — production that significantly underperformed against league baselines. His best Total Average season came in 1960, posting .468, well below the league average of .658 that year. The lowest point came in 1957 at .197, well below the league average of .644 that year.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from .393 in 1963 to .269 in 1964 and .313 in 1965.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. Some season-to-season variance runs through the career line, but the career average remained well below league norms across 12 seasons.
